Specifications

Product Category Supervisory Circuits Type Voltage Monitor
Mounting Style SMD/SMT Threshold Voltage 3.08 V
Number of Inputs Monitored 1 Input Output Type Active Low, Push-Pull
Manual Reset No Manual Reset Watchdog Timers No Watchdog
Battery Backup Switching No Backup Reset Delay Time 460 ms
Supply Voltage - Max 5.5 V Minimum Operating Temperature - 40 C
Maximum Operating Temperature + 105 C Chip Enable Signals No Chip Enable
Features No Internal Hysteresis Height 0.94 mm
Length 2.9 mm Operating Supply Current 800 nA
Overvoltage Threshold 3.11 V Power Fail Detection No
Product Type Supervisory Circuits Factory Pack Quantity 3000
Subcategory PMIC - Power Management ICs Supply Voltage - Min 1 V
Undervoltage Threshold 3.08 V Width 1.3 mm
Unit Weight 0.000282 oz Package/Case SOT-23
